Who is Yoshua Bengio?

Yoshua Bengio isn't just some random professor; he's a full-blown AI rockstar. Born in Paris, France, Bengio's academic journey led him to McGill University in Montreal, where he earned his Ph.D. in computer science in 1991. Now, he's a professor at the Université de Montréal and the founder and scientific director of Mila, the Quebec Artificial Intelligence Institute. Mila is one of the world's largest academic research centers for deep learning. Bengio's influence extends far beyond academia. Bengio's Key Contributions to Deep Learning

Deep learning, the field where Bengio has made significant contributions, has revolutionized everything from image recognition to natural language processing. So, what exactly has he done? One of Bengio's most influential contributions is his work on recurrent neural networks (RNNs) and their application to language modeling. RNNs are a type of neural network that are particularly well-suited for processing sequential data, like text or speech. Bengio and his team developed novel techniques for training RNNs, which allowed them to learn complex patterns in language and generate realistic text. This work laid the foundation for many of the natural language processing applications we use today, such as machine translation and chatbots.

Another key area of Bengio's research is in the development of attention mechanisms. Attention mechanisms allow neural networks to focus on the most relevant parts of the input when making predictions. For example, when translating a sentence from English to French, an attention mechanism can help the network focus on the words in the English sentence that are most important for translating the current word in the French sentence. Bengio's work on attention mechanisms has significantly improved the performance of neural networks on a wide range of tasks, including machine translation, image captioning, and speech recognition. In addition to his work on RNNs and attention mechanisms, Bengio has also made important contributions to the development of generative models. Generative models are a type of neural network that can generate new data that is similar to the data they were trained on. For example, a generative model trained on images of faces could generate new images of faces that look realistic but are not actually of any real person. Bengio and his team have developed novel techniques for training generative models, which have led to breakthroughs in areas such as image synthesis and drug discovery.
